What a Desert Resort Needs From Energy

Hospitality properties in the low desert run cooling loads most of the year, and guest comfort is not negotiable. Electricity is a structural operating cost, not a line item you can trim by turning things off.

Borrego Springs adds two complications. First, the heat itself: sustained extreme temperatures stress panels, inverters, and wiring, and undermine systems that were designed for milder climates. Second, the location: this is a remote community, which puts a premium on a system that is built to run reliably without a service truck nearby.

The goal for this project was simple to state and demanding to execute: offset 100% of the property's utility usage with a system engineered to survive the desert for the long haul.

Engineering Choices That Mattered

Ground mount over rooftop

Putting the array on the ground kept the resort's roofs untouched and gave the design team full control over orientation and layout. It also makes every component accessible for inspection and service, which matters more, not less, at a remote site.

Designed for heat, not just sunshine

Desert irradiance is exceptional, but high temperatures reduce panel output and stress electrical components. The system was engineered specifically for extreme desert heat, using Tier-1 equipment backed by 25-year manufacturer warranties, so production holds up in August, not just on the spec sheet.

The Economics of a System This Size

We do not publish client financials, and we do not dress up estimates as results. Here is what published market data says about systems in this class, clearly labeled as illustrative:

Illustrative estimate: not this client's actual costs or savings

  • - Southern California commercial solar in 2026 typically runs $2.20–$3.20 per watt installed before incentives, with sub-100kW systems landing at the higher end of that range. Simple arithmetic puts a 46kW system roughly between $101,000 and $147,000 before incentives, likely toward the top of that band at this size.
  • - The 30% federal ITC applies to commercial systems, and because this system is well under 1MW, the full credit applies without prevailing wage and apprenticeship requirements.
  • - With the 30% ITC plus MACRS depreciation, well-designed California commercial systems typically pay back in 5–8 years. A property with heavy daytime cooling consumption sits at the favorable end of that logic, since on-site consumption during operating hours preserves returns under NEM 3.0's reduced export compensation.
